A gracious 18th century Adam building set in 2.5 acres, centrally situated in the beautiful spa town of Moffat - several times winner of the `Scotland in Bloom` Award.

The Moffat House makes an ideal base from which to explore the delightful countryside and attractions of Dumfries & Galloway and the Scottish Borders.

Award-winning restaurant with top chefs preparing individual dishes using fresh local produce…Solway salmon, venison and local Galloway beef. Well appointed, recently modernised en-suite rooms with colour television, radio, hairdryer and tea/coffee facilities. Group Affiliations:Best Western Ratings/Awards:3 Stars Number of Rooms:21 Number Ensuite:21 Restaurant Name:Hopetouns Cuisine:Scottish/Modern Chef:Leishman Awards:1 AA Rosette
